pipelines BitBucket Pipelines 테스트 환경과 배포 환경이 다른 이미지 사용 BitBucket Pipelines가 편리했기 때문에 여러가지 놀고 있었다. 그 중에서, 만들고 있는 어플리케이션이 Node였으므로 테스트는 Node의 Docker 이미지 사용하고 싶지만, 배포는 Python이 필요하므로 Python의 Docker 이미지 사용하고 싶다. 라는 말을 깨닫기 위해 해본 것을 정리해 둔다. (더 괜찮습니까? 어떤 방법을 아는 분이 있으면 알려주세요) node:7.... pipelinesBitbucket Azure DevOps로 iOS용 Unity 자동 빌드 환경 구축 위에서는 자동 빌드를 할 준비와 파트를 소개했지만, 이번에는 실제로 Microsoft-hosted 환경에서 Unity의 자동 빌드 환경을 구축하고 싶습니다. 벌써 소개 끝난 기사로 대범은 커버 할 수 있기 때문에, 정리 같은 기사가 되고 있습니다만 양해 바랍니다. Microsoft-hosted이므로, 로컬에 환경이 없어도 Unity의 라이센스만 있으면 클라우드상에서 빌드 환경을 구축할 수 있... QiitaAzureUnityAzureAzureDevOpspipelines Azure Pipelines에서 로컬 환경을 Agent로 만드는 방법(Mac) Azure Pipelines에서 로컬 환경을 Agent로 만드는 방법을 소개합니다. Xcode 프로젝트의 경우 Carthage에서 빌드한 라이브러리 등도 남아 있으므로, 2번째 이후의 빌드 시간을 대폭 단축할 수 있습니다. 개인의 환경에 의존해 버리기 때문에, 프로덕션으로 운용하려면 CI/CD용의 머신을 준비해야 합니다. 로컬 환경의 CPU나 메모리를 압박한다 따라서 개발용 머신을 프로덕션용... AzureAzureDevOpspipelinesMicrosoftAzurePipelines AZ DEVOPS를 사용하여 AAD 그룹 만들기 이 세션에서는 Azure DevOps를 사용하여 AAD(Azure Active Directory) 그룹을 만드는 방법을 시연합니다. 중요 사항:- 이름이 같은 AAD 그룹을 하나 이상 만들 수 있습니다. AAD 그룹의 고유 식별자는 개체 ID입니다. 클라우드 엔지니어는 그룹을 만들기 위해 Azure Active Directory에 액세스할 수 없습니다. 클라우드 엔지니어는 AAD 그룹을 생성... pipelinesazuredevopscommunity AZ DEVOPS를 사용하여 스토리지 계정 키 회전 이 세션에서는 저장소 계정 키(기본 및 보조)를 회전하고 Azure DevOps를 사용하여 Key Vault에 저장하는 방법을 시연합니다. 리소스 그룹이 없으면 파이프라인이 실패합니다. 지정된 리소스 그룹 내에 저장소 계정이 있는지 확인합니다. 스토리지 계정이 없으면 파이프라인이 실패합니다. Key Vault를 찾을 수 없으면 파이프라인이 실패합니다. 위의 모든 유효성 검사가 성공하면 교체하... devopspipelinescommunityazure 다단계로 가속화 Docker 이미지 구축 이런 간단한 단점은 당신이 정말 필요로 하지 않는 물건을 가득 담은 거대한 용기를 구축하기 쉽다는 것이다.대부분의 Docker 미러는 기본 미러로 Debian 또는 Ubuntu를 사용합니다.이것은 호환성과 쉬운 설치에 유리하지만, 이러한 기본 이미지는 용기의 비용을 증가시킬 수 있다.예를 들어 Node의 간단한 Hello World 응용 프로그램입니다.js는 거의 700MB입니다. 아시다시피... pipelinesdevopsmultistagedocker Azure 파이핑에서 캐시를 사용하여 구축 시간을 줄이는 방법 파이핑 캐시는 나중에 실행될 때 실행된 출력이나 다운로드의 의존 항목을 다시 사용할 수 있도록 함으로써 구축 시간을 줄이고 같은 파일을 다시 만들거나 다운로드하는 비용을 줄이거나 피할 수 있습니다. 그러나 Azure Pipelines 에이전트에 대해 말하자면, 새로운 파이프라인이 실행될 때마다 이 실행을 위해 다시 만든 에이전트 기기에 있기 때문에 CICD 프로세스에 필요한 바이너리 파일과 ... pipelinescachedevopsazuredevops 개선된 Zenml 0.5를 소개합니다.x 우리는 매우 흥분하여 최종적으로 당신과 이 새로운 ZenML버전에 대한 세부 사항을 공유합니다! 우리는 이 블로그에서 주요한 새로운 기능을 소개할 것이지만, 만약 당신이 상세한 목록을 원한다면, 반드시 우리의 을 보십시오. 새로운 ZenML functional API는 기계 학습 파이프의 모든 단계를 번거롭게 하위 클래스화할 필요가 없습니다. 이것은 ZenML 파이프에서 실행할 수 있도록 기... pipelinesmlopspythonmachinelearning Bitbucket 파이프라인 작곡가 캐시 디렉토리가 비어 있습니다 🤷♂️ TL;DR: composer saved cache in different directory then Bitbucket's predefined composer cache location. Adding COMPOSER_HOME=~/.composer before the composer install fixed the issue. 우리 회사에서는 Bitbucket을 Git 호스팅 서비스로 사용하고 ... bitbuckercachecomposerpipelines circleback 모드를 사용하는 고급 파이프 배열 본문에서 우리는 더욱 진일보할 것이다.나는 첫 번째 파이프가 다른 파이프를 촉발할 뿐만 아니라, 다른 파이프가 완성되기를 기다리고 있는 예시를 제공할 것이다.나는 작업을 끝낼 때 신호를 보내기 위해 두 번째 파이프로 되돌아오는 것을 circleback 모드라고 부른다.이 모델을 사용하면 더욱 좋은 통합 테스트와 더욱 복잡한 배치와 발표 장면을 실현할 수 있다. 두 파이프 모두 API 키를 설... cicdpipelinescircleci
BitBucket Pipelines 테스트 환경과 배포 환경이 다른 이미지 사용 BitBucket Pipelines가 편리했기 때문에 여러가지 놀고 있었다. 그 중에서, 만들고 있는 어플리케이션이 Node였으므로 테스트는 Node의 Docker 이미지 사용하고 싶지만, 배포는 Python이 필요하므로 Python의 Docker 이미지 사용하고 싶다. 라는 말을 깨닫기 위해 해본 것을 정리해 둔다. (더 괜찮습니까? 어떤 방법을 아는 분이 있으면 알려주세요) node:7.... pipelinesBitbucket Azure DevOps로 iOS용 Unity 자동 빌드 환경 구축 위에서는 자동 빌드를 할 준비와 파트를 소개했지만, 이번에는 실제로 Microsoft-hosted 환경에서 Unity의 자동 빌드 환경을 구축하고 싶습니다. 벌써 소개 끝난 기사로 대범은 커버 할 수 있기 때문에, 정리 같은 기사가 되고 있습니다만 양해 바랍니다. Microsoft-hosted이므로, 로컬에 환경이 없어도 Unity의 라이센스만 있으면 클라우드상에서 빌드 환경을 구축할 수 있... QiitaAzureUnityAzureAzureDevOpspipelines Azure Pipelines에서 로컬 환경을 Agent로 만드는 방법(Mac) Azure Pipelines에서 로컬 환경을 Agent로 만드는 방법을 소개합니다. Xcode 프로젝트의 경우 Carthage에서 빌드한 라이브러리 등도 남아 있으므로, 2번째 이후의 빌드 시간을 대폭 단축할 수 있습니다. 개인의 환경에 의존해 버리기 때문에, 프로덕션으로 운용하려면 CI/CD용의 머신을 준비해야 합니다. 로컬 환경의 CPU나 메모리를 압박한다 따라서 개발용 머신을 프로덕션용... AzureAzureDevOpspipelinesMicrosoftAzurePipelines AZ DEVOPS를 사용하여 AAD 그룹 만들기 이 세션에서는 Azure DevOps를 사용하여 AAD(Azure Active Directory) 그룹을 만드는 방법을 시연합니다. 중요 사항:- 이름이 같은 AAD 그룹을 하나 이상 만들 수 있습니다. AAD 그룹의 고유 식별자는 개체 ID입니다. 클라우드 엔지니어는 그룹을 만들기 위해 Azure Active Directory에 액세스할 수 없습니다. 클라우드 엔지니어는 AAD 그룹을 생성... pipelinesazuredevopscommunity AZ DEVOPS를 사용하여 스토리지 계정 키 회전 이 세션에서는 저장소 계정 키(기본 및 보조)를 회전하고 Azure DevOps를 사용하여 Key Vault에 저장하는 방법을 시연합니다. 리소스 그룹이 없으면 파이프라인이 실패합니다. 지정된 리소스 그룹 내에 저장소 계정이 있는지 확인합니다. 스토리지 계정이 없으면 파이프라인이 실패합니다. Key Vault를 찾을 수 없으면 파이프라인이 실패합니다. 위의 모든 유효성 검사가 성공하면 교체하... devopspipelinescommunityazure 다단계로 가속화 Docker 이미지 구축 이런 간단한 단점은 당신이 정말 필요로 하지 않는 물건을 가득 담은 거대한 용기를 구축하기 쉽다는 것이다.대부분의 Docker 미러는 기본 미러로 Debian 또는 Ubuntu를 사용합니다.이것은 호환성과 쉬운 설치에 유리하지만, 이러한 기본 이미지는 용기의 비용을 증가시킬 수 있다.예를 들어 Node의 간단한 Hello World 응용 프로그램입니다.js는 거의 700MB입니다. 아시다시피... pipelinesdevopsmultistagedocker Azure 파이핑에서 캐시를 사용하여 구축 시간을 줄이는 방법 파이핑 캐시는 나중에 실행될 때 실행된 출력이나 다운로드의 의존 항목을 다시 사용할 수 있도록 함으로써 구축 시간을 줄이고 같은 파일을 다시 만들거나 다운로드하는 비용을 줄이거나 피할 수 있습니다. 그러나 Azure Pipelines 에이전트에 대해 말하자면, 새로운 파이프라인이 실행될 때마다 이 실행을 위해 다시 만든 에이전트 기기에 있기 때문에 CICD 프로세스에 필요한 바이너리 파일과 ... pipelinescachedevopsazuredevops 개선된 Zenml 0.5를 소개합니다.x 우리는 매우 흥분하여 최종적으로 당신과 이 새로운 ZenML버전에 대한 세부 사항을 공유합니다! 우리는 이 블로그에서 주요한 새로운 기능을 소개할 것이지만, 만약 당신이 상세한 목록을 원한다면, 반드시 우리의 을 보십시오. 새로운 ZenML functional API는 기계 학습 파이프의 모든 단계를 번거롭게 하위 클래스화할 필요가 없습니다. 이것은 ZenML 파이프에서 실행할 수 있도록 기... pipelinesmlopspythonmachinelearning Bitbucket 파이프라인 작곡가 캐시 디렉토리가 비어 있습니다 🤷♂️ TL;DR: composer saved cache in different directory then Bitbucket's predefined composer cache location. Adding COMPOSER_HOME=~/.composer before the composer install fixed the issue. 우리 회사에서는 Bitbucket을 Git 호스팅 서비스로 사용하고 ... bitbuckercachecomposerpipelines circleback 모드를 사용하는 고급 파이프 배열 본문에서 우리는 더욱 진일보할 것이다.나는 첫 번째 파이프가 다른 파이프를 촉발할 뿐만 아니라, 다른 파이프가 완성되기를 기다리고 있는 예시를 제공할 것이다.나는 작업을 끝낼 때 신호를 보내기 위해 두 번째 파이프로 되돌아오는 것을 circleback 모드라고 부른다.이 모델을 사용하면 더욱 좋은 통합 테스트와 더욱 복잡한 배치와 발표 장면을 실현할 수 있다. 두 파이프 모두 API 키를 설... cicdpipelinescircleci